Hi !
I'm using V2 for building my own applications and try to
convince my
colleagues to use it, too.
Unfortunately, there are annoying warnings from now 4 boost
modules
creeping up in my build-logs like
----begin copy ---
searching for python.exe in C:/Python24/bin
warning: Graph library does not contain optional GraphML
reader.
note: to enable GraphML support, set EXPAT_INCLUDE and
EXPAT_LIBPATH to
the
note: directories containing the Expat headers and
libraries,
respectively.
warning: skipping optional Message Passing Interface (MPI)
library.
note: to enable MPI support, add "using mpi ;" to
user-config.jam.
note: to suppress this message, pass
"--without-mpi" to bjam.
note: otherwise, you can safely ignore this message.
--- end copy ---
Those are
1) Boost.Python
2) BGL GraphML Reader
3) MPI support
4) Boost.Regex ICU support.
I'd like those warnings to appear _only_ when those
libraries/modules
are actually _built_ or used, but not when their Jamfiles
are _parsed_.
I'd really appreciate it if someone with more bjam knowledge
than me
would fix it (at least in HEAD, I can then post the patch to
my
colleagues...).
